WebConnect to a wired (Ethernet) network. To set up most wired network connections, all you need to do is plug in a network cable. The wired network icon ( ) is displayed on the top bar with three dots while the connection is being established. The dots disappear when you are connected. Click TCP/IP in the sidebar, click the Configure IPv4 pop-up menu, then choose ... happy differencesWebMar 18, 2024 · Most MoCA adapters are configured similarly. To set up MoCA adapters: Connect one MoCA adapter to your Internet router via an Ethernet cable and to the coax wall outlet via a MoCA-capable coax splitter. You can skip this step if you have a MoCA-capable router, although additional router configuration may be needed. chalks houston texasWebMay 13, 2024 · Bottom line.
